Zanzibar
Zanzibar is one of East Africa’s most captivating destinations, offering a perfect mix of natural beauty, culture, and relaxation. Located in the Indian Ocean, the island is famous for its pristine white-sand beaches, crystal-clear turquoise waters, and swaying palm trees that create a true tropical paradise. Whether you’re unwinding on the shores of Nungwi or Kendwa, snorkeling in coral reefs, or enjoying a traditional dhow cruise at sunset, Zanzibar provides an unforgettable coastal experience.
Beyond the beaches, Zanzibar is rich in history and culture. Stone Town,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, is a maze of narrow streets, ancient buildings, carved wooden doors, and vibrant markets that reflect a blend of African, Arab, and European influences. Visitors can explore spice farms, discover the island’s role in the historic trade routes, and experience the warm hospitality of the Swahili culture. Zanzibar is the perfect destination to relax after a safari or Kilimanjaro climb, offering both tranquility and cultural depth in one unforgettable location.
